We compared two Professional market GPUs: 16GB VRAM Jetson Orin NX 16 GB and 16GB VRAM Tesla V100 FHHL to see which GPU has better performance in key specifications, benchmark tests, power consumption, etc.
Main Differences
NVIDIA Jetson Orin NX 16 GB 's Advantages
Released 4 years and 11 months late
Lower TDP (25W vs 250W)
NVIDIA Tesla V100 FHHL 's Advantages
Boost Clock1290MHz
Larger VRAM bandwidth (829.4GB/s vs 102.4GB/s)
4096 additional rendering cores
